KFC finally put out a statement on operating under level 3. And they confirm the use of paywave. 

 

 

 

https://www.kfc.co.nz/store-updates/

 

 

 

 

So close, you can almost taste it 🍗

We’ll soon be back frying the chicken you love but with even more safety measures in place.  As part of our commitment to safety, the front counter will remain closed for now, but you can still get KFC contact free by visiting the drive thru or ordering home delivery. 

 

As  part of our increased safety measures, we have paywave available and will only be accepting cashless payments.  We will also be operating a limited menu in the short term, you can find details here

 

To ensure the health and wellbeing of our customers, team and community we’ll be opening our stores in a phased approach.  For the most up to date information check this page regularly.   

 

Thanks for your understanding, we look forward to serving you soon.
